Concert Group appoints chief actuary


Fronting business Concert Group Holdings has appointed Sam LaDuca as chief actuary. Reporting to Concert chief executive officer Jonathan Reiss, he’ll begin in April.

LaDuca joins Concert after 25 years with Merchants Insurance Group, where he held several senior positions, most recently executive vice president for product, underwriting and actuarial. Before Merchants, he worked for three years at PricewaterhouseCoopers as a senior consultant in the firm’s casualty actuarial and risk management practice.

He is a Fellow of the Casualty Actuarial Society and a member of the American Academy of Actuaries and holds the Chartered Property Casualty Underwriter designation.

“With Sam’s hire, Concert’s full executive team is now in place,” said Reiss. “He’s an excellent addition, bringing broad operational capabilities and underwriting leadership in addition to his extensive actuarial experience.

“As we’ve been completing our final executive hires, we’ve also been making rapid progress in broadening our licensing footprint. Our E&S carrier, Concert Specialty, began underwriting in December 2021, and our admitted carrier, Concert Insurance, is currently approved in 31 US states, with more approvals expected within the next few weeks.

The company, which  launched last June, is headquartered in Chicago, and it continues to recruit for its offices in Florida and New Jersey.

“We feel our successful recruitment of top talent, as well as the market’s keen interest in doing business with us, are testament to Concert’s vision of being a new kind of fronting company,” said Reiss.
